CEO/Creative Director: Niekko Chin

Niekko Headshot

Niekko Chin began his career as a dancer in New York City. He studied Modern Jazz at the Dance Theatre of Harlem and started performing in music videos and tours for various artists. Niekko honed his skills through work at major theme park attractions, show productions, corporate musical theater, dinner theater, dance, television and live production. In 1984, he formed the New Vision Cirque & Dance Company, which later became Cirque USA and at the time was a group of traveling performers (acrobats, gymnasts, aerialist, stunt and cirque artists, ballet and hip hop dancers) that would tour the country for clients such as Pfizer, BMW, Sony and Rolls Royce. Niekko also produced shows for major corporations which included Bell South, AT&T, Pfizer, IBM, Microsoft, Sony and Sharp Electronics. He also produced live shows for Disney; and provided cirque performers for Prince, Cher, MTV Video Music Awards after party for Usher, John Travolta Super Bowl Party 2008 and private events for Donald Trump. Niekko's creative and original concepts have earned him the reputation of an industry trendsetter, and continue to earn him accolades for each new show he produces.

Artistic Director: Leslie Ferrelli

 

Leslie graduated with a BFA in dance Performance in 2004 from the University of the Arts, in Philadelphia. Working with the Delaware Valley Jazz Company instilled Leslie with determination and dedication as well as igniting her passion for dance, performance and perfection.  While attending University of the Arts, she has been lucky enough to study with some of the nations best dance teachers, Ruth Andrian, Pat Thomas, Faye Snow, Andrew Pap, Kip Martin, Mia Michaels, Cuban Pete and Jennifer Binford among others.  Working extensively with Roni Koresh of the Koresh Dance Company to master his unique style of jazz combined with modern dance, Leslie discovered her passion for choreography.  She has worked with several dance companies such as Tournado Dance Company, Contempra Dance Theater and DRIP to name a few.  Leslie has been performing internationally with Cirque USA since 2003. In 2005, she accepted the role as Artistic Director for Cirque USA.  Since then she has been acting as choreographer for the company and producing corporate and theater shows internationally.   

Theatre Tour Manager: Marisa Knight

Marisa is a graduate of Ohio Northern University with a BA in Theatre and Modern Dance. Throughout her college career, she was a stage manager, actress or dancer in over 16 productions. She was also given opportunities to study under internationally known dancers such as James Sewell, Roni Koresh, Tom and Susana Evert and Demetrius Klein. Most recently, she completed a certification program in Isadora Duncan Studies. She has traveled to Scotland to perform in the Edinburgh Fringe Festival, and then to New York as a Director of Choreography in the Macy’s Thanksgiving Day parade. In 2004, she moved to West Palm Beach, Florida where she decided to concentrate solely on Ballroom and Latin dance at the successful Dancin’ Dance Centre. She is also a certified Makeup Artist from Joe Blasco Makeup School, and is extremely happy to be back to her theatre roots with Cirque USA.
